Uzbekistan tops medal table at Asian Junior Judo Championships in Jakarta
The Asian Junior Judo Championships concluded in Jakarta, Indonesia, with Uzbekistan’s national team emerging as the undisputed leader of the tournament.

Uzbek athletes delivered an outstanding performance, winning a total of 14 medals – including 8 gold, 3 silver, and 3 bronze – to secure first place in the overall team standings.
The gold medalists included:
- Sugdiyona Rafqatova (–52 kg)
- Samariddin Quchqorov (–60 kg)
- Dilshodbek Hamroev (–66 kg)
- Umida Nigmatova (+78 kg)
- Samandar Muhibiddinov (–81 kg)
- Alisher Samanov (–90 kg)
- Muhammadali Zoirov (–100 kg)
- Fazliddin Rafiqov (+100 kg)
Silver medals went to Bunyod Safarov (–73 kg), Rayhona Mamatova (–57 kg), and Nigina Saparboeva (–63 kg). Bronze medals were claimed by Muhriddin Ma’rufov (–73 kg), Sevinch Murodova (–48 kg), and Mohinur Allaberganova (–57 kg).
